Wyndham Clark: Spotlight on the Rising PGA Tour Star and His Hero World Challenge Controversy

Since his stunning victory at the 2023 U.S. Open, PGA Tour professional Wyndham Clark has found himself in the limelight, making headlines both for his on-course performances and off-course controversies. This new wave of visibility has drawn the attention of fans, analysts, and sports reporters, eager to dissect both his game and his candid personality. Following his U.S. Open win, Clark has continued to spark conversations within the golf community, particularly after a series of notable comments and events.

The most significant controversy surrounding Clark occurred earlier this summer at the U.S. Open, where he faced backlash for damaging property at the historic Oakmont Country Club. After an emotionally charged incident that saw him smashing lockers in the locker room, his actions led to a suspension by the club and a public apology in which he stated that he “did something awful.” The incident served as a reminder that beneath the polished exterior of professional golf lies a realm of intense emotions, competitiveness, and, at times, regrettable actions.

Fast forward to the 2025 Hero World Challenge, where Clark’s competitive spirit was once again on display. Despite tying for the lead in the first round with a score of 66, he chose to voice his displeasure regarding the course conditions at Albany Golf Club, which is hosting the tournament. His straightforward critique stirred conversations about the challenges golf professionals face on difficult courses, particularly when playing on Bermuda grass—known for its tricky lies and grainy texture.

When asked about the chipping conditions at Albany, Clark didn’t hold back. In a moment of raw honesty, he queried, “Do you want the politically correct answer?” before sharing his candid thoughts that the course was “not in good shape.” His statements, while perhaps unrefined, highlight the authenticity that many fans appreciate in modern professional athletes. With such a high-stakes environment, it’s clear that the pressure can lead to passionate responses, which audiences and fellow players alike might find both relatable and refreshing.

This isn’t just about Clark, though; his comments had a ripple effect within the field. Fellow competitor Scottie Scheffler, who also shot a 66 in his opening round, was asked a similar question and provided a more diplomatic response. “I think the grain has a lot to do with it,” he noted, indicating the slight variances in how each player perceives the complex nature of the course. This contrast between Clark’s forthright remarks and Scheffler’s composed answer directly illustrates the diverse personalities that populate the PGA Tour.

Adding to the nuances of the conversation around Albany GC, Corey Conners, who carded a 67, echoed a shared sentiment about the Bermuda grass, commenting on its unforgiving nature. “The ball just kind of sits down a little bit,” Conners explained, highlighting the need for precision and touch in short-game situations. This emphasis on the nuances of chipping conditions coincides with the growing trend in golf of analyzing course setups and conditions through the eyes of the players, creating intriguing narratives that captivate fans.

As the tournament progresses, Clark finds himself in a crowded leaderboard, tied with four other competitors, including the reigning champion, Scottie Scheffler. Both players are eyeing the coveted title, adding an additional layer of intensity to the Hero World Challenge. Fans are eagerly anticipating whether Clark can channel the same drive that led him to his U.S. Open success or if the weight of public scrutiny and course challenges will impact his performance.
